Tim Hortons was originally concentrated in Ontario and Atlantic Canada. However, the chain has greatly expanded its presence into Quebec and western Canada. [78] Its location in Iqaluit, Nunavut, was the northernmost store as of 2010. [79] Its location in Alert, Nunavut, is the northernmost store as of 2024.
